All-Star Preview
A look at the latest in baseball as well as my all-start Picks:
AL
1B: Jason Giambi, Yankees
2B: Ian Kinsler, Rangers
SS: Orlando Cabrera, White Sox
3B: Alex Rodriguez, Yankees
C: Joe Mauer, Twins
OF: Josh Hamilton, Rangers
OF: Milton Bradley, Rangers
OF: Manny Ramirez, Red Sox
DH: Hideki Matsui, Yankees
NL
1B: Lance Berkman, Astros
2B: Dan Uggla, Marlins
SS: Hanley Ramirez, Marlins
3B: Chipper Jones, Braves
C: Brian McCann, Braves
OF: Ryan Bruan, Brewers
OF: Alfonso Soriano, Cubs
OF: Ryan Ludwick, Cardinals
